About the Author: Julie Bogart

Julie Bogart, a seasoned writer and educator, brings a wealth of experience to the table. Her educational philosophies, combined with her practical approach, form the foundation of her successful company, Brave Writer, which aids parents in teaching writing effectively. Known for her enlightening educational approach, Bogart has cultivated a significant following who deeply appreciate her work.

A Fresh Perspective on Homeschooling

The Brave Learner offers a fresh, insightful perspective on the homeschooling journey. Bogart shares her experiences and strategies for transforming education into a magical learning adventure. The book delves into four vital forces—curiosity, collaboration, contemplation, and celebration—which lead to a rich learning environment. The blend of heartfelt guidance and innovative practices motivates readers to foster their children’s natural love of learning.
